I know there are many food choices in Epcot but this one is fantastic! We loved the entertainment and we ate scallops (2) and steak with shrimp (1), we also ordered tuna appetizer to try and DH is now in love with seared tuna!!
Desserts were green tea ice cream, green tea cake, ginger cake - all great!
This was THE BEST meal we had at Disney and we would have eaten here again and again had we known. We will return!!

We have been waiting to try this forever but this was a big disappointment. We did have a nice view of the pool area and the fire lighter and his little show outside - but the food was a huge letdown. The bread was dry, food came out in a strange order and they never gave us salad , we had to ask for sauces etc for meats - large platter had decent pot stickers and wings -meats that came out on the skewers were peppery and dry and some were burnt black and inedible - dessert was good but too much for us to finish - we really felt rushed to eat and go so they could fill our spots - maybe it isn't what it used to be but anyhow we will not return - KONA is a much better option for food and service

My family stayed at POFQ at the end of November. I have stayed at value, moderates and deluxe levels. This was the first time at French Quarter and my last. The rooms are in sad need of repair. Furniture is old and worn. Rooms are outdated. We arrived the evening of the re-opening of the food court. What a disappointment. It is small with very limited choices. I kept wishing we were at Pop Century over this place. The Front Desk staff was not helpful and disinterested. The boat to Disney Springs was great but the boat captain was rude and hateful. We had to wait over 45 minutes for a bus to Epcot one morning. The line stretched all the way to the main building. The trip itself was great but the resort was not. Will not be returning.

We ate here in October and were looking forward very excited to have their delicious pot roast and vegetarian sandwich for lunch 12/3. Had we known the menu had changed we would have canceled our reservations. The menu is an all you can eat buffet for $35 and a few a la carte items. There are no vegetarian dishes unless you do not have shrimp or chicken on the salad. Will not be returning to this restaurant.
